Warning Signs You Need Flooring Replacement After Water Damage

Ignoring the warning signs of water damage can lead to costly repairs down the line. In Flat Rock, NC, it’s essential to be aware of the signs and symptoms of water damage to your flooring. Our team can help you identify the issues and provide a solution before they become major problems.

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away

Strong, unpleasant odors can be a sign of water damage, especially if they persist despite your best efforts to remove them. This is often due to the growth of mold and mildew in the affected area. Mold growth can be hazardous to your health, and prompt attention is essential to prevent further damage.

Warped or Buckled Flooring

Water damage can cause flooring to warp or buckle, creating uneven surfaces and safety hazards. This can be a sign of underlying damage that needs immediate attention. Warped flooring can lead to further damage and costly repairs if left unchecked.

Water Stains or Discoloration

Water stains or discoloration on your flooring can be a sign of water damage. These stains can be difficult to remove and may need professional attention to prevent further damage. Water stains can also be a sign of underlying structural issues that need prompt attention.

Soft or Spongy Flooring

Soft or spongy flooring can be a sign of water damage, especially if it’s accompanied by other warning signs like warping or buckling. This can be a sign of underlying damage that needs immediate attention. Soft flooring can be a safety hazard and can lead to further damage if left unchecked.

Peeling or Cracking Paint or Wallpaper

Peeling or cracking paint or wallpaper can be a sign of water damage, especially if it’s accompanied by other warning signs like warping or buckling. This can be a sign of underlying damage that needs prompt attention. Peeling paint can lead to further damage and costly repairs if left unchecked.

Visible Water Leaks or Stains

Visible water leaks or stains on your flooring or walls can be a sign of water damage. These leaks can be a sign of underlying structural issues that need prompt attention. Visible leaks can lead to further damage and costly repairs if left unchecked.
